在当今数字化时代,线上平台的评分系统已成为消费者决策的重要参考,也是商家经营的关键指标。无论是外卖平台的餐厅评分、电商平台的店铺评分,还是本地生活服务的商家评分,这些数字背后隐藏着复杂的机制和深远的影响。本文将深入探讨评分系统的运作原理、如何影响消费者的购买决策,以及商家如何利用评分优化经营策略。
一、评分系统的构成与运作机制
1.1 评分的计算方式
大多数平台的评分系统采用加权平均算法,但具体规则因平台而异。以常见的外卖平台为例,评分通常由以下因素构成:
- 用户评分:消费者在完成订单后对商家进行的星级评价(通常为1-5星)。
- 评价内容:文字评价、图片、视频等,这些内容会影响评分的权重。
- 评价时间:近期评价的权重通常高于历史评价。
- 用户信誉:高信誉用户的评价可能被赋予更高权重。
- 异常检测:平台会过滤掉刷单、恶意差评等异常数据。
示例代码:一个简化的评分计算模型(Python伪代码):
def calculate_rating(reviews, weights):
"""
计算加权平均评分
reviews: 列表,每个元素为(评分, 用户信誉分, 评价时间权重)
weights: 字典,包含各因素的权重
"""
total_score = 0
total_weight = 0
for review in reviews:
# 提取评分、信誉分和时间权重
score, credibility, time_weight = review
# 计算该评价的综合权重
combined_weight = (weights['credibility'] * credibility +
weights['time'] * time_weight)
# 加权得分
total_score += score * combined_weight
total_weight += combined_weight
return total_score / total_weight if total_weight > 0 else 0
# 示例数据
reviews = [
(4.5, 0.9, 0.8), # 评分4.5,信誉分0.9,时间权重0.8
(3.0, 0.7, 0.9), # 评分3.0,信誉分0.7,时间权重0.9
(5.0, 0.95, 0.7) # 评分5.0,信誉分0.95,时间权重0.7
]
weights = {'credibility': 0.6, 'time': 0.4}
final_rating = calculate_rating(reviews, weights)
print(f"最终评分: {final_rating:.2f}")
1.2 评分的动态变化
评分不是静态的,而是随着时间不断变化的动态指标。平台通常采用以下机制:
- 滚动窗口:只显示最近一段时间(如30天、90天)的评价。
- 衰减机制:旧评价的权重随时间逐渐降低。
- 实时更新:新评价会立即影响当前评分。
示例:假设一家店铺有100条评价,平均评分4.5分。如果新增一条1星差评,且该评价权重较高(如用户信誉高、近期评价),评分可能迅速降至4.3分。反之,如果新增一条5星好评,评分可能微升至4.51分。
二、评分如何影响消费者的选择
2.1 评分作为决策过滤器
消费者在浏览大量选项时,评分常作为第一道过滤器。研究表明:
- 高评分吸引点击:评分高于4.5分的店铺点击率比4.0分以下的店铺高出300%。
- 低评分直接排除:评分低于4.0分的店铺,70%的消费者会直接忽略。
- 评分区间敏感:消费者对4.2-4.5分的店铺差异不敏感,但对4.0分以下的店铺非常敏感。
案例分析:在外卖平台搜索“披萨”时,系统通常按评分排序。假设用户看到以下结果:
- 店铺A:评分4.8分,评价数2000条
- 店铺B:评分4.6分,评价数5000条
- 店铺C:评分4.2分,评价数1000条
大多数用户会优先考虑A和B,而C可能被直接跳过,即使C的配送距离更近或价格更低。
2.2 评分与评价内容的协同效应
评分数字本身不足以反映全部信息,评价内容同样重要:
- 文字评价:详细描述菜品质量、服务态度、配送速度等。
- 图片/视频:直观展示商品实物,增强可信度。
- 追评:用户使用一段时间后的反馈,更具参考价值。
示例:一家评分4.3分的餐厅,评价中频繁出现“分量足”、“味道正宗”等正面描述,可能比一家评分4.5分但评价中多为“包装简陋”、“配送慢”的餐厅更受青睐。
2.3 评分的“马太效应”
高评分店铺更容易获得更多曝光和订单,形成良性循环;低评分店铺则陷入恶性循环:
- 高评分 → 更多曝光 → 更多订单 → 更多好评 → 评分更高
- 低评分 → 曝光减少 → 订单减少 → 可能因资源不足导致服务下降 → 更多差评 → 评分更低
数据支持:某外卖平台数据显示,评分4.7分以上的店铺月订单量是4.0分以下店铺的10倍以上。
三、商家如何利用评分优化经营策略
3.1 提升评分的实用方法
商家可以通过以下策略主动提升评分:
3.1.1 优化产品与服务
- 质量控制:确保每一份订单的品质稳定。
- 包装改进:防止配送过程中洒漏、变形。
- 配送管理:与可靠配送团队合作,或自建配送体系。
代码示例:商家可以使用简单的数据分析工具监控评分变化:
import pandas as pd
import matplotlib.pyplot as plt
# 模拟评分数据
data = {
'date': pd.date_range(start='2023-01-01', periods=30),
'rating': [4.2, 4.3, 4.1, 4.4, 4.5, 4.6, 4.5, 4.4, 4.3, 4.2,
4.1, 4.0, 3.9, 3.8, 3.7, 3.6, 3.5, 3.4, 3.3, 3.2,
3.1, 3.0, 2.9, 2.8, 2.7, 2.6, 2.5, 2.4, 2.3, 2.2]
}
df = pd.DataFrame(data)
# 绘制评分趋势图
plt.figure(figsize=(10, 6))
plt.plot(df['date'], df['rating'], marker='o', linestyle='-', color='b')
plt.axhline(y=4.0, color='r', linestyle='--', label='警戒线')
plt.title('店铺评分30天趋势')
plt.xlabel('日期')
plt.ylabel('评分')
plt.legend()
plt.grid(True)
plt.xticks(rotation=45)
plt.tight_layout()
plt.show()
# 计算平均评分和下降速度
avg_rating = df['rating'].mean()
decline_rate = (df['rating'].iloc[0] - df['rating'].iloc[-1]) / 30
print(f"30天平均评分: {avg_rating:.2f}")
print(f"评分下降速度: {decline_rate:.4f}分/天")
3.1.2 主动管理评价
- 及时回复差评:展示解决问题的态度,可能促使用户修改评价。
- 鼓励好评:通过优质服务自然获得好评,避免诱导好评(可能违反平台规则)。
- 处理异常评价:对恶意差评进行申诉。
示例:商家回复差评的模板:
尊敬的顾客,非常抱歉给您带来不好的体验。关于您提到的[具体问题],我们已采取以下措施:1. 与相关员工沟通加强培训;2. 优化[具体流程]。希望您能再给我们一次机会,我们将提供[补偿措施]。如有任何问题,请随时联系我们。
3.2 评分与经营数据的关联分析
商家应将评分与其他经营指标结合分析,制定综合策略:
| 指标 | 与评分的关系 | 商家应对策略 |
|---|---|---|
| 订单量 | 正相关,评分每提升0.1分,订单量增加约5-10% | 优先提升评分,再优化其他指标 |
| 客单价 | 评分高的店铺可适当提高价格 | 通过提升品质支撑更高定价 |
| 复购率 | 评分直接影响复购意愿 | 重点关注老客户体验 |
| 投诉率 | 负相关,评分低通常投诉率高 | 建立投诉快速响应机制 |
代码示例:分析评分与订单量的关系
import numpy as np
from sklearn.linear_model import LinearRegression
# 模拟数据:评分与日订单量
ratings = np.array([3.0, 3.2, 3.5, 3.8, 4.0, 4.2, 4.5, 4.7, 4.9, 5.0])
orders = np.array([50, 65, 80, 95, 110, 130, 160, 190, 220, 250])
# 线性回归分析
model = LinearRegression()
model.fit(ratings.reshape(-1, 1), orders)
# 预测不同评分对应的订单量
predicted_orders = model.predict(np.array([3.0, 4.0, 5.0]).reshape(-1, 1))
print(f"评分与订单量的线性关系: y = {model.coef_[0]:.2f}x + {model.intercept_:.2f}")
print(f"预测结果:")
print(f" 评分3.0 → 订单量: {predicted_orders[0]:.0f}")
print(f" 评分4.0 → 订单量: {predicted_orders[1]:.0f}")
print(f" 评分5.0 → 订单量: {predicted_orders[2]:.0f}")
3.3 应对评分危机的策略
当评分突然下降时,商家需要快速响应:
- 诊断问题:分析差评内容,找出共性问题。
- 制定改进计划:针对问题制定具体解决方案。
- 透明沟通:向顾客说明改进措施。
- 监控效果:持续跟踪评分变化。
案例:某餐厅因包装问题导致评分从4.5降至4.1。商家采取以下措施:
- 立即更换更牢固的包装材料
- 增加包装检查环节
- 在评价中回复说明改进措施
- 一周后评分回升至4.4
四、评分系统的局限性与改进方向
4.1 现有评分系统的问题
- 刷单与虚假评价:商家通过虚假交易提升评分。
- 恶意差评:竞争对手或不满顾客的恶意评价。
- 评价偏差:极端评价(1星或5星)占比较高,中间评价较少。
- 平台算法不透明:商家难以理解评分变化的具体原因。
4.2 改进建议
- 引入多维度评分:如质量、服务、配送等分项评分。
- 增加评价验证:通过订单验证确保评价真实性。
- 提供商家反馈渠道:让商家对异常评价提出申诉。
- 透明化算法:向商家解释评分计算规则。
代码示例:多维度评分系统设计
class MultiDimensionalRating:
def __init__(self):
self.dimensions = ['quality', 'service', 'delivery', 'value']
self.weights = {'quality': 0.4, 'service': 0.3, 'delivery': 0.2, 'value': 0.1}
def calculate_overall_rating(self, dimension_scores):
"""
计算综合评分
dimension_scores: 字典,包含各维度评分
"""
total = 0
for dim in self.dimensions:
if dim in dimension_scores:
total += dimension_scores[dim] * self.weights[dim]
return total
def get_dimension_breakdown(self, dimension_scores):
"""获取各维度评分详情"""
breakdown = []
for dim in self.dimensions:
if dim in dimension_scores:
breakdown.append(f"{dim}: {dimension_scores[dim]}分 (权重{self.weights[dim]})")
return breakdown
# 示例使用
rating_system = MultiDimensionalRating()
scores = {'quality': 4.5, 'service': 4.2, 'delivery': 4.8, 'value': 4.0}
overall = rating_system.calculate_overall_rating(scores)
breakdown = rating_system.get_dimension_breakdown(scores)
print(f"综合评分: {overall:.2f}")
print("各维度评分:")
for item in breakdown:
print(f" {item}")
五、消费者与商家的双赢策略
5.1 消费者的明智选择
- 综合评估:不要只看评分,还要阅读评价内容。
- 关注近期评价:近期评价更能反映当前服务质量。
- 考虑自身需求:不同消费者对不同维度的重视程度不同。
- 理性评价:基于真实体验给出客观评价,避免情绪化。
5.2 商家的长期经营
- 重视客户体验:将评分视为客户满意度的指标,而非单纯数字。
- 建立反馈机制:主动收集客户意见,及时改进。
- 诚信经营:避免刷单等违规行为,维护平台生态健康。
- 数据驱动决策:结合评分与其他经营数据,制定科学策略。
六、结论
评分系统作为连接消费者与商家的桥梁,其影响深远而复杂。对消费者而言,评分是决策的重要参考,但需结合其他信息综合判断;对商家而言,评分是经营的晴雨表,但不应成为唯一目标。只有双方都理性对待评分,才能构建健康、可持续的商业生态。
未来,随着人工智能和大数据技术的发展,评分系统有望变得更加智能和公平,更好地服务于消费者和商家。但无论技术如何进步,优质的产品和服务始终是赢得高评分的根本,也是商业成功的永恒法则。
